The main difference between a Director Yolo County and a Program Manager Yolo County lies in their scope and responsibilities. Directors focus on strategic leadership and high-level decision-making, while Program Managers handle day-to-day program operations and team management. Both roles are essential in government settings, but they differ in seniority and focus areas.
